SALSA MEATLOAF

INGREDIENTS

  • Cooking Time: 2 hrs
  • Servings: 6-7
  • Preparation Time: 15
  • 1 lb lean Ground Beef
  • 1 lb bulk Sausage
  • ½ c thick bottled Salsa
  • ½ c chopped Onion
  • ½ c chopped Green Pepper
  • ¼ c chopped Green Onion (green and white parts)
  • ¼ c finely chopped Shallots
  • 1-2 clove of Garlic, minced
  • 1 eggs
  • 2/3 c dried Seasoned Breadcrumbs
  • 1 tsp Seasoned Salt (Lowery's or your favorite)
  • ½ tsp Pepper
  • 1/2 tsp Mrs. Dash Original Season Blend
  • 1 tsp Chili Powder

DIRECTIONS

In a large bowl, combine everything (using your hands works best); mix well but do not over-handle the meat – over-handling will make a tough meatloaf. Shape into a loaf and place in a 9 x 13 casserole dish (not a loaf pan). Bake at 350 for about an hour, or until a meat thermometer reads 165 degrees when inserted in the center. Let cool for 5-10 minutes before slicing and serving. Serve with additional salsa if desired.


Note: What makes this meatloaf different is the combination of all the different onions and garlic.


Note: I mold the meatloaf into 2 football shapes and bake them in a lidded casserole dish for 2 hours, turning once after 1 hour. I prefer them not to be pink at all.
